Output 34c2b3b883a4b178218204e011de3f982a323b5e17a7f3859ed3edb77c5f6085:40

value
1113342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57b8b5442116e5f68e791dbaa0847d21e1042e93 OP_EQUAL
address
39gqyyVKNUKtPfr4BKtxrVMACBE63JoJV9
transaction
34c2b3b883a4b178218204e011de3f982a323b5e17a7f3859ed3edb77c5f6085
confirmations
215474
spent
true